What is Loratadine?
Loratadine is an antihistamine commonly used to alleviate symptoms associated with allergies. It effectively works by blocking the action of histamines in the body, which are responsible for common allergic reactions, such as sneezing, a runny nose, and itchy or watery eyes.

Potential Side Effects
Loratadine is generally well-tolerated. However, some individuals may experience mild side effects, which can include:
- Headache
- Dry mouth
- Fatigue
- Stomach discomfort
